The MELROSE DEMOCRATIC CITY COMMITTEE will hold a CAUCUS TO ELECT DELEGATES TO THE DEMOCRATIC STATE CONVENTION.
Registered Democrats in Melrose will hold an in-person caucus on Wednesday March 11, 2026 at the First Congregational Church at 121 W. Foster St. to elect delegates and alternates to the 2026 Massachusetts Democratic State Convention. Doors will open at 6 PM and the Caucus will begin at 6:30 PM, sharp. There will be no virtual or hybrid component.
The caucus is open to all registered and pre-registered Democrats in Melrose. Democrats who will be 16 or older by March 29, 2026 will be allowed to participate and run as a delegate or alternate. Youth, minorities, people with disabilities, and LGBTQ individuals who are not elected as a delegate or alternate may apply to be an add-on delegate at the caucus or
at www.massdems.org.
Democrats who are unable to attend the caucus but are interested in being elected as alternate delegates may submit their name in writing via email ([email protected]) to the Melrose Democratic City Committee prior to the caucus date.
The 2026 Massachusetts Democratic Party State Convention will convene to elect the delegates who will endorse statewide candidates, including candidates for Governor, at the Convention in Worcester. This is also an important opportunity for Democrats across Massachusetts to come together to unite behind our shared values and organize to win up and down the ballot. The Convention will be held on May 29th and May 30th, 2026, at the DCU Center in Worcester, MA.
